Digital Solution Area Specialist
Are you passionate about helping Education organisations unlock the full potential of their data and artificial intelligence capabilities? As a Digital Sales Solution Specialist focused on AI Workforce, you will lead strategic digital sales engagements with K–12 institutions, delivering Microsoft’s AI-powered solutions—including Copilot—to drive productivity, streamline workflows, and enhance employee engagement. You’ll bring deep industry insights into customer conversations, acting as a thought leader in digital transformation across solution areas. Your ability to articulate how AI and automation can reshape the way people work—while advancing security and compliance—will be key to helping customers realise the full value of their digital transformation journey. As a **Digital Sales Solution Specialist,** you will drive opportunity qualification and pipeline growth by leveraging internal stakeholders and partners, using frameworks aligned with Microsoft’s Customer Engagement Methodology and pipeline hygiene standards. You’ll lead digital envisioning workshops and prototyping engagements that accelerate decision-making and alignment, manage the rhythm of the business through structured cadences, and collaborate across sales, marketing, and partner teams to deliver integrated solutions. This role blends strategic engagement, technical acumen, and collaborative execution to deliver measurable outcomes and empower Education customers to build a more agile, AI-enabled workforce.
